# What's in this image?
|
||||
|
||||
This image is built from official rootfs tarballs provided by Canonical (specifically, https://partner-images.canonical.com/core/).
|
||||
|
||||
The `ubuntu:latest` tag points to the "latest LTS", since that's the version recommended for general use.
